Josephine Marie Parr was born in 1920 in New Jersey, the child of Arthur S Parr And Ethel Margaret Isabella Morton. In 1930, Josephine Marie Parr resided in White, Warren, New Jersey, USA. In 1935, Josephine Marie Parr resided in Hope, Warren, New Jersey. Josephine Marie Parr married Perry Princeton Pyle, Perry Princeton Pyle Jr, and had children including Kathy Pyle, Newborn Pyle. Josephine Marie Parr passed away in 2017 in Denver, Denver County, Colorado, United States of America.
